MS6000 Microform Scanner
Overview
Read on screen, print on paper, scan to PC—the digital era gives you powerful new ways
to use microform information. Now there's a microform scanner that makes it easy to do
all three.
The Minolta MS6000 gives you dual output, to switch from PC scanning to high-speed
laser printing at the touch of a button. Connected to a PC, the MS6000 allows scanning at
up to 800 dpi—to use and distribute your microform information in websites, emails, faxes
and desktop publishing.
There's a wide range of microform media options for film, fiche, jacket and card formats.
Modular scanner and printer design lets you set up your system to suit your workspace—
and two scanners can even share a single printer, for extra cost-efficiency in multi-user
applications.

Features
Proven Technology:
The MS6000 builds upon Minolta's experience with the popular MicroSP2000 and
MS2000 Reader/Printers to give you one of the most reliable, user-friendly microform
systems on the market.
Simple Dual Output:
Simple front-panel controls let you switch from high-quality laser prints at up to 20 sheets
per minute to scanning into your PC at up to 800 dpi resolution.
Anti-Glare Screen:
A high-resolution 12" x 12" anti-glare screen with adjustable screen brightness makes
reading microform information easier on your eyes.
